A game tick is where Minecraft's game loop runs once. The game normally runs at a fixed rate of 20 ticks per second, so one tick happens every 0.05 seconds (50 milliseconds, or five hundredths of a second, or one twentieth of a second), making an in-game day last exactly 24000 ticks, or 20 minutes. As a result, it is quite sensible to cache the results from a mesher and only ever ...Suppose we wanted to know how many hostile mobs can spawn if there are 2 players in the world, 1 km apart (so their spawning regions don't overlap). There will be 2 * 17 * 17 = 578 chunks. The constant for "monster" is 70. So the mob cap is 70 * 578 / 289 = 140. You can only run this command in a fresh world with no chunks unlocked. `/trigger ChunkSpreadPlayers` - Spread players around the world in a 1000 x …A Chunk is a 16×16 structure that is 384 blocks tall. It goes 64 blocks deep into the world and caps out at the height of 320. A Chunk is made up of 98,304 blocks in total. More Chunks keep spawning around the player as they continue to explore. In the top left the number of ChunkLoaders ...Actually, SSDs are faster - in many cases MUCH faster (hundreds of times; hard drives are very limited by their IOPS performance), and in my experience disk I/O is the least important factor in chunk generation - how come I can copy a quarter-gig world in 5-10 seconds (to the same drive, so it has to read and write a total of half a gig of data, and this is a standard 7200 RPM hard drive ...Around X/Z ±29,999,984, there is a world border in Minecraft. Chunks still generate past this point, but the player cannot go past ±30 million blocks out. Is Minecraft world bigger than Earth? Yes, the Minecraft world is larger than Earth.
